- 1. Scheduled date for next refueling shutdown.
Unit permanently shutdown on November 30, 1992
- 2. Scheduled date for restart following refueling.
None.
- 3. Will refueling or resumption of operation thereafter require a Technical Specification change or other license amendment?-
Operation will not be resumed.
A Possession Only License was issued on October 23, 1992, which will become ef fective when the NRC is notified that all. fuel has been offloaded from the core.
It-is anticipated that the reactor will be defueled in mid-March.
Permanently Defueled Technical Specifications are in the process of being developed.
- 4. Scheduled date for submitting proposed licensing action and supporting information.
Not yet determined.
